Study Undermines Argument Against Race-Sensitive Admissions

The “mismatch” hypothesis—sometimes called the “fit” hypothesis—predicts that race-sensitive admissions harm some minority students by placing them in academic environments that are too rigorous and thwart their chances of graduation. A new study challenges this hypothesis.
